آلن تورینگ ریاضی‌دان، دانشمند رایانه، منطق‌دان، فیلسوف، زیست-ریاضیدان، و رمزنگار بریتانیایی بود. تورینگ به عنوان پدر علم محاسبهٔ نوین و هوش مصنوعی شناخته شده‌ است و مهم‌ترین جایزه ی علمی رایانه به افتخار وی جایزهٔ تورینگ نام گرفته‌ است.

آلن تورینگ یک ریاضیدان انگلیسی بود که در جنگ جهانی دوم توانست با رمزگشایی از ماشین انیگما که به وسیله آن نازی‌ها هر ۲۴ ساعت سیستم رمزنگاری پیام‌های خود را تغییر می‌دادند، جان تعداد زیادی از مردم را نجات دهد. او برای این کار از ماشینی استفاده کرد که می‌توانست منطق الگوریتم انیگما را شبیه‌سازی کند. ماشین تورینگ بعدها به شدت مورد توجه قرار گرفت و به همین دلیل وی را پدر علوم کامپیوتر و رمزنگاری می‌نامند.

 

ماشین تورینگ

آلن تورینگ در سال ۱۹۳۷ مقاله ای را با عنوان درباره ی اعداد و محاسبه پذیر منتشر کرد که به اندازه ی هر رویداد منحصر به فردی دیگری می تواند آغاز عصر جدید کامپیوتر تلقی شود. این مقاله به اختصار طرحی از آنچه را شرح می دهد که به آن ماشین تورینگ می گویند و آن کامپیوتری بود که شالوده اش در قلب کامپیوترهای دیجیتال بعدی قرار دارد. این موضوع به تمام جنبه های کامپیوترهای ابتدایی تا مدرن، همچون توانایی خواندن، نوشتن و پاک کردن داده ها، حافظه ای برای ذخیره سازی داده ها، یک واحد پردازش مرکزی و به معنای یک برنامه به واسطه مجموعه ای از دستور العمل های ریاضیاتی ساخته شده، شکل داد. این وسیله به شکلی که توصیف شده بود هرگز ساخته نشد ولی عملا به شکلی پیشرفته و اصلاح شده از دهه ی ۱۹۵۰ به تولید انبوه رسید.

 

ماشین انیگما
انیگما نام دسته‌ای از ماشین‌های الکترومکانیکی مبتنی بر روتر است که برای رمزنگاری و رمزگشایی پیام های محرمانه به‌ کار می‌رفته است. این ماشین در سال‌های 1920 میلادی به عنوان یک محصول تجاری عرضه شد. ارتش نازی مدل خاصی از این ماشین به نام انیگمای ورماخت را تولید نمود و از آن در جنگ جهانی دوم به‌ کار برد. متفقین با تلاش دانشمندان و ریاضی‌دانان از جمله آلن تورینگ موفق به گشودن رمز پیام‌های ارتش آلمان‌ها شدند.